29
383
90
17
522
138
76
60
26
129
40
43
82
46
215
131
118
67
74
394
52
87
181
790
1036
93
23
99
234
86
998
50
44
39
94
55
59
133
68
203
147
108
141
113
56
333
189
319
233
390
386
57
183
212
150